What you'll do:
- Support Manager in executing corporate campaigns aligned with organisational goals, ensuring consistent delivery of high-quality programmes.
- Assist in the end-to-end execution of flagship corporate projects, including industry engagement activities, tech and services exhibitions, thought-leadership conferences, success case promotions, and networking/ceremonial events.
- Coordinate with external vendors, contractors, and internal stakeholders to deliver impactful initiatives that meet performance targets.
- Copywriting of official invitation letters, marketing correspondences, materials and implement relevant events in collaboration with internal divisions.
- Build and strengthen strategic relationships with local, GBA, and global organisations to enhance HKPC’s visibility, partnerships, and thought leadership.
- Support team in digitalising the Project Satisfaction Poll to automate monthly customer satisfaction reporting.
- Manage client and stakeholder inquiries through HKPC’s touchpoints.
- Bachelor’s degree or higher in Marketing Communications, Event Management, or a related field, or equivalent professional experience.
- A highly experienced event professional with a minimum of 4 years in corporate events, exhibitions, and stakeholder engagement.
- Strong project management capabilities, with a keen eye for detail and the ability to apply analytical and creative thinking to overcome challenges and adapt to unexpected changes during event execution.
- Customer-oriented, with good communications, interpersonal, presentation and problem-solving skills
- Strong sense of responsibility, able to work under pressure and meet tight deadline, willing to work outside office hours
- Proficiency in MS Word, Excel, PowerPoint and Chinese Word Processing
- Candidates who can demonstrate knowledge of AI, or experience and ability to apply Generative AI tools in their work, will be preferred
- Good command of both written and spoken English and Chinese including Putonghua
